Deployed Medical & Healthcare Delivery returned for its 11th year and took place on 24–25 March 2025 at the Millennium Gloucester Hotel and Conference Centre in Kensington, London.

Officially supported by the UK’s Defence Medical Services, DMHD 2025 attracted 250+ representatives from across military medical components, academia, and industry to discuss the operational challenges faced when delivering care to the frontline.

The 2025 conference offered:

  • First-hand insights from the new UK Surgeon General, who shared his vision for the future of medical care delivery, including plans for how allies and industry would contribute to operational success.
  • A larger, more interactive exhibition hall showcasing the latest medical capabilities to assist in the treatment and management of patients in conflicts.
  • High-level briefings on civilian/military cooperation in full-scale combat, with input from civilian counterparts who shared their challenges and observations from working alongside the military.
  • Increased representation from NATO nations, humanitarian actors, and industry representatives who shared knowledge and built new connections within the community.
